服务器性能测试主要是测什么,系统服务器性能测试报告
- 综合资讯
- 2024-11-01 02:04:46
- 2

服务器性能测试主要测量服务器的响应时间、吞吐量、并发处理能力等关键指标,以评估其稳定性和效率。系统服务器性能测试报告应详细列出测试方法、结果分析以及针对测试中发现的性能...
服务器性能测试主要测量服务器的响应时间、吞吐量、并发处理能力等关键指标,以评估其稳定性和效率。系统服务器性能测试报告应详细列出测试方法、结果分析以及针对测试中发现的性能瓶颈提出的优化建议。
随着信息技术的不断发展,服务器已成为企业信息化建设的重要支撑,为了确保服务器能够满足业务需求,提高系统稳定性,保障数据安全,对服务器进行性能测试显得尤为重要,本文将对系统服务器性能测试的主要内容和过程进行详细介绍。
测试目的
1、了解服务器硬件性能指标,为服务器选型和升级提供依据。
2、评估服务器在运行业务时的性能表现,为优化系统提供参考。
3、保障服务器在高负载情况下的稳定性,预防系统崩溃。
4、提高服务器运维人员对系统性能的掌握,提升运维效率。
1、硬件性能测试
(1)CPU性能测试:通过运行各种CPU密集型任务,如大型计算、编译、加密等,评估CPU的运算能力和处理速度。
(2)内存性能测试:通过运行内存密集型任务,如数据库查询、文件读写等,评估内存的读写速度和带宽。
(3)硬盘性能测试:通过读写硬盘数据,如文件拷贝、数据库备份等,评估硬盘的读写速度和I/O性能。
(4)网络性能测试:通过模拟网络传输数据,如数据包传输、网络延迟等,评估网络带宽和稳定性。
2、系统性能测试
(1)操作系统性能测试:通过监控操作系统关键指标,如CPU使用率、内存使用率、磁盘I/O等,评估操作系统性能。
(2)数据库性能测试:通过模拟数据库操作,如查询、插入、更新、删除等,评估数据库的响应速度和并发处理能力。
(3)应用性能测试:通过模拟实际业务场景,如用户访问、数据处理等,评估应用系统的性能表现。
3、安全性能测试
(1)漏洞扫描:对服务器进行安全漏洞扫描,发现潜在的安全风险。
(2)入侵检测:模拟攻击场景,评估服务器在遭受攻击时的防护能力。
测试方法
1、工具选择
(1)硬件性能测试:使用AIDA64、CPU-Z、CrystalDiskMark等工具。
(2)系统性能测试:使用性能监控工具,如Prometheus、Zabbix等。
(3)数据库性能测试:使用SQL查询性能测试工具,如SQLMap、DBXplorer等。
(4)安全性能测试:使用安全漏洞扫描工具,如Nessus、OpenVAS等。
2、测试步骤
(1)确定测试目标:根据测试目的,明确测试内容和方法。
(2)搭建测试环境:配置测试硬件、软件和网络环境。
(3)收集测试数据:运行测试任务,收集性能数据。
(4)分析测试结果:对测试数据进行统计分析,评估性能表现。
(5)优化建议:根据测试结果,提出优化建议。
测试结果与分析
1、硬件性能测试结果
(1)CPU性能:在运行大型计算任务时,CPU使用率稳定在80%左右,性能表现良好。
(2)内存性能:在运行内存密集型任务时,内存读写速度较快,带宽充足。
(3)硬盘性能:在读写硬盘数据时,硬盘读写速度较快,I/O性能良好。
(4)网络性能:在模拟网络传输数据时,网络带宽充足,延迟较低。
2、系统性能测试结果
(1)操作系统性能:在运行业务场景时,CPU使用率稳定在60%左右,内存使用率在80%左右,磁盘I/O性能良好。
(2)数据库性能:在模拟数据库操作时,查询、插入、更新、删除等操作均能快速响应。
(3)应用性能:在模拟实际业务场景时,应用系统性能表现良好,用户访问流畅。
3、安全性能测试结果
(1)漏洞扫描:未发现严重的安全漏洞。
(2)入侵检测:在模拟攻击场景下,服务器能够有效抵御攻击。
1、结论
通过本次系统服务器性能测试,发现服务器硬件性能、系统性能和安全性能均能满足业务需求,但在实际应用中,仍需关注以下方面:
(1)合理配置硬件资源,确保服务器在高负载情况下稳定运行。
(2)优化系统配置,提高系统性能。
(3)加强安全防护,预防潜在安全风险。
2、建议
(1)定期对服务器进行性能测试,及时发现性能瓶颈,进行优化。
(2)关注行业动态,及时更新硬件和软件,提高服务器性能。
(3)加强安全意识,定期进行安全检查,保障服务器安全稳定运行。
本文对系统服务器性能测试的主要内容和过程进行了详细介绍,通过对服务器硬件、系统、数据库和应用性能的测试,可以全面了解服务器的性能表现,为优化系统提供依据,关注服务器安全性能,保障数据安全,提高运维效率。
本文链接:https://www.zhitaoyun.cn/474645.html
发表评论